Transaction 95ca98820dd6f8c6c292e9e5ec3dd043088e828906b1322fd7f1dcdc109e408a
1 Input
1 Output
-
95ca98820dd6f8c6c292e9e5ec3dd043088e828906b1322fd7f1dcdc109e408a:0
- value
- 504853
- script pubkey
- OP_0 OP_PUSHBYTES_20 1df1a3d6c4e5f71d611d9e1f7f00f72620919db3
- address
- bc1qrhc684kyuhm36cganc0h7q8hycsfr8dnd6k2ul